[Pkg-cups-devel] stupid dependencies on update-inetd
    Marco d'Itri 
    md at Linux.IT
       
    Sat Jul 28 22:57:03 UTC 2007
    
    
  
I don't know exactly how it happened, but a large number of maintainers
apparently ignored the discussions on this list and added to their
packages a dependency on update-inetd.
This is *TOTALLY WRONG* because the /usr/sbin/update-inetd interface is
guaranteed to be provided by whatever implements the inet-superserver
virtual package and not by the update-inetd package currently depended
on by some inetd packages.
Indeed, the update-inetd package does not depend on a daemon package nor
it provides one itself.
Some of these packages instead are only slightly less broken and depend
both on inet-superserver and update-inetd, making impossible to install
a future xinetd package providing its own /usr/sbin/update-inetd.
For the same reason the dependency on netbase must be removed,
especially now that it does not depend anymore on inet-superserver.
(I know that in theory I should have waited for all packages to be fixed
before removing the dependency, but realistically this would not have
happened before lenny or lenny+1...)
grep-dctrl -s Package,Depends --field=Depends update-inetd \
  --and --not --field=Provides inet-superserver /var/lib/dpkg/available
Richard A Nelson (Rick) <cowboy at debian.org>
   sendmail
Masayuki Hatta (mhatta) <mhatta at debian.org>
   ebnetd
Jari Aalto <jari.aalto at cante.net>
   micro-httpd
Russ Allbery <rra at debian.org>
   kftgt
   remctl
   sident
Chris Butler <chrisb at debian.org>
   wu-ftpd
Debian CUPS Maintainers <pkg-cups-devel at lists.alioth.debian.org>
   cupsys
Debian Qt/KDE Maintainers <debian-qt-kde at lists.debian.org>
   kdenetwork
Debian Samba Maintainers <pkg-samba-maint at lists.alioth.debian.org>
   samba
Ludovic Drolez <ldrolez at debian.org>
   atftp
Turbo Fredriksson <turbo at debian.org>
   midentd
Debian QA Group <packages at qa.debian.org>
   ffingerd
Sam Hartman <hartmans at debian.org>
   krb5
Michael Holzt <debian-gwhois at michael.holzt.de>
   gwhois
John H. Robinson, IV <jaqque at debian.org>
   nullidentd
Alberto Gonzalez Iniesta <agi at inittab.org>
   linux-ftpd
LTSP Debian/Ubuntu Maintainers <pkg-ltsp-devel at lists.alioth.debian.org>
   ltsp
Martin Loschwitz <madkiss at debian.org>
   gidentd
Francesco Paolo Lovergine <frankie at debian.org>
   proftpd-dfsg
Robert Luberda <robert at debian.org>
   solid-pop3d
Rene Mayorga <rmayorga at debian.org.sv>
   afbackup
Steve McIntyre <93sam at debian.org>
   cvs
Pedro Zorzenon Neto <pzn at debian.org>
   fakepop
Anibal Monsalve Salazar <anibal at debian.org>
   bootp
   bsd-finger
   pidentd
Steve McIntyre <93sam at debian.org>
   cvs
Pedro Zorzenon Neto <pzn at debian.org>
   fakepop
Anibal Monsalve Salazar <anibal at debian.org>
   bootp
   bsd-finger
   pidentd
Martin Schulze <joey at debian.org>
   sendfile
Jonas Smedegaard <dr at jones.dk>
   uw-imap
paul cannon <pik at debian.org>
   hotway
-- 
ciao,
Marco
    
    
More information about the Pkg-cups-devel
mailing list